"Moxa" is a word in ENGLISH

moxa ENGLISH
Definition:

A soft woolly mass prepared from the young leaves of
Artemisia Chinensis, and used as a cautery by burning it on the skin;
hence, any substance used in a like manner, as cotton impregnated with
niter, amadou.

moxa ENGLISH
Definition:

A plant from which this substance is obtained, esp. Artemisia
Chinensis, and A. moxa.
